Building the Future of Chips: The Semiconductor Fabrication Materials Market

Overall, the semiconductor fabrication materials market is expected to grow at a promising CAGR of 7.2% in the long run to reach US$ 59.7 Billion by 2028.

The Semiconductor Fabrication Materials Market focuses on materials used in the production of semiconductors, enabling precise and reliable chip manufacturing. Key features include high purity, chemical stability, thermal and electrical performance, and compatibility with advanced lithography and deposition processes. Fabrication materials include photoresists, etchants, cleaning chemicals, dielectric and insulating materials, chemical vapor deposition (CVD) precursors, and various specialty gases.

Applications

Semiconductor fabrication materials are used across integrated circuit (IC) manufacturing, MEMS devices, LEDs, power electronics, and advanced packaging. They support photolithography, etching, deposition, cleaning, and planarization processes in semiconductor fabs. These materials are critical for producing processors, memory chips, sensors, and high-performance devices used in consumer electronics, automotive electronics, telecommunications, and industrial applications. Advanced semiconductor nodes rely heavily on precise and high-quality fabrication materials to meet performance and reliability requirements.

Trends

The market is witnessing growth driven by the adoption of advanced semiconductor nodes and the increasing complexity of ICs. Demand for high-purity chemicals and gases, environmentally friendly materials, and process-optimized solutions is rising. Materials for EUV (Extreme Ultraviolet) lithography, high-k/metal gate technologies, and 3D packaging are gaining importance. Sustainability and circular economy initiatives are influencing material selection and process design.
